1 Jacó pôs-se de novo a caminho e foi para a terra dos filhos do oriente.1 After Jacob resumed his journey, he came to the land of the Easterners.
2 Olhando em torno de si, viu no campo um poço junto do qual estavam deitados três rebanhos de ovelhas. Este poço servia de bebedouro para os rebanhos. Mas, sendo grande a pedra que cobria a abertura do poço2 Looking about, he saw a well in the open country, with three droves of sheep huddled near it, for droves were watered from that well. A large stone covered the mouth of the well.
3 somente a removiam de cima quando todos os rebanhos fossem recolhidos. Davam então de beber aos animais e recolocavam a pedra no seu lugar.3 Only when all the shepherds were assembled there could they roll the stone away from the mouth of the well and water the flocks. Then they would put the stone back again over the mouth of the well.
4 Jacó disse aos pastores: "Meus irmãos, de, onde sois?" "Somos de Harã", responderam.4 Jacob said to them, "Friends, where are you from?" "We are from Haran," they replied.
5 "Conheceis porventura Labão, filho de Nacor?" "Sim."5 Then he asked them, "Do you know Laban, son of Nahor?" "We do," they answered.
6 "Como vai ele?" "Vai muito bem; e eis justamente sua filha Raquel que vem com o rebanho."6 He inquired further, "Is he well?" "He is," they answered; "and here comes his daughter Rachel with his flock."
7 "É ainda pleno dia, tornou Jacó, e não é hora de se recolherem os rebanhos. Dai de beber às ovelhas e levai-as de novo ao pasto."7 Then he said: "There is still much daylight left; it is hardly the time to bring the animals home. Why don't you water the flocks now, and then continue pasturing them?"
8 "Não o podemos, responderam eles, antes que todos os rebanhos estejam reunidos. Tiramos então a pedra de cima do poço e damos de beber aos animais."8 "We cannot," they replied, "until all the shepherds are here to roll the stone away from the mouth of the well; only then can we water the flocks."
9 Falava ainda com eles, quando chegou Raquel com o rebanho do seu pai, porque era pastora.9 While he was still talking with them, Rachel arrived with her father's sheep; she was the one who tended them.
10 Logo que Jacó viu Raquel, filha de Labão, irmão de sua mãe, aproximou-se, rolou a pedra de cima da boca do poço e deu de beber às ovelhas de Labão.10 As soon as Jacob saw Rachel, the daughter of his uncle Laban, with the sheep of his uncle Laban, he went up, rolled the stone away from the mouth of the well, and watered his uncle's sheep.
11 Depois beijou Raquel e pôs-se a chorar.11 Then Jacob kissed Rachel and burst into tears.
12 Contou-lhe que era parente de seu pai e filho de Rebeca; e ela correu a anunciar isto ao seu pai.12 He told her that he was her father's relative, Rebekah's son, and she ran to tell her father.
13 Tendo Labão ouvido falar de Jacó, filho de sua irmã, correu-lhe ao encontro, abraçou-o, beijou-o e o conduziu à sua casa. Jacó contou-lhe tudo o que se tinha passado,13 When Laban heard the news about his sister's son Jacob, he hurried out to meet him. After embracing and kissing him, he brought him to his house. Jacob then recounted to Laban all that had happened,
14 e Labão disse-lhe: "Sim, tu és de meus ossos e de minha carne." Jacó ficou em casa dele um mês inteiro.14 and Laban said to him, "You are indeed my flesh and blood." After Jacob had stayed with him a full month,
15 E Labão disse-lhe: "Acaso, porque és meu parente, servir-me-ás de. raça? Dize-me que salário queres."15 Laban said to him: "Should you serve me for nothing just because you are a relative of mine? Tell me what your wages should be."
16 Ora, Labão tinha duas filhas: a mais velha chamava-se Lia, e a mais nova Raquel.16 Now Laban had two daughters; the older was called Leah, the younger Rachel.
17 Lia tinha os olhos embaciados, e Raquel era bela de talhe e rosto.17 Leah had lovely eyes, but Rachel was well formed and beautiful.
18 Jacó, que amava Raquel, disse a Labão: "Eu te servirei sete anos por Raquel tua filha mais nova."18 Since Jacob had fallen in love with Rachel, he answered Laban, "I will serve you seven years for your younger daughter Rachel."
19 "E melhor, respondeu Labão, dá-la a ti que a outro: fica comigo."19 Laban replied, "I prefer to give her to you rather than to an outsider. Stay with me."
20 Assim, Jacó serviu por Raquel sete anos, que lhe pareceram dias, tão grande era o amor que lhe tinha.20 So Jacob served seven years for Rachel, yet they seemed to him but a few days because of his love for her.
21 Disse, pois, a Labão: "Dá-me minha mulher, porque está completo o meu tempo e quero desposá-la."21 Then Jacob said to Laban, "Give me my wife, that I may consummate my marriage with her, for my term is now completed."
22 Labão reuniu. todos os habitantes do lugar e deu um banquete.22 So Laban invited all the local inhabitants and gave a feast.
23 Mas, à noite, conduziu, Lia a Jacó, que se uniu com ela.23 At nightfall he took his daughter Leah and brought her to Jacob, and Jacob consummated the marriage with her.
24 E deu à sua filha Lia, sua escrava Zelfa.24 (Laban assigned his slave girl Zilpah to his daughter Leah as her maidservant.)
25 Pela manhã, viu Jacó que tinha ficado com Lia. E disse a Labão: "Que me fizeste? Não foi por Raquel que te servi? Por que me enganaste?"25 In the morning Jacob was amazed: it was Leah! So he cried out to Laban: "How could you do this to me! Was it not for Rachel that I served you? Why did you dupe me?"
26 "Aqui, respondeu Labão, não é costume casar a mais nova antes da mais velha.26 "It is not the custom in our country," Laban replied, "to marry off a younger daughter before an older one.
27 Acaba a semana com esta, e depois te darei também sua irmã, na condição que me sirvas ainda sete anos."27 Finish the bridal week for this one, and then I will give you the other too, in return for another seven years of service with me."
28 Assim fez Jacó: acabou a semana com Lia, e depois lhe deu Labão por mulher sua filha Raquel,28 Jacob agreed. He finished the bridal week for Leah, and then Laban gave him his daughter Rachel in marriage.
29 dando por serva a Raquel sua escrava Bala.29 (Laban assigned his slave girl Bilhah to his daughter Rachel as her maidservant.)
30 Jacó uniu-se também a Raquel, a quem amou mais do que a Lia. E serviu ainda por sete anos em casa de Labão.30 Jacob then consummated his marriage with Rachel also, and he loved her more than Leah. Thus he remained in Laban's service another seven years.
31 O Senhor, vendo que Lia era desprezada, tornou-a fecunda enquanto Raquel permanecia estéril.31 When the LORD saw that Leah was unloved, he made her fruitful, while Rachel remained barren.
32 Lia concebeu e deu à luz um filho, ao qual chamou Rubem, "porque, dizia ela, o Senhor olhou minha aflição; agora meu marido me amará".32 Leah conceived and bore a son, and she named him Reuben; for she said, "It means, 'The LORD saw my misery; now my husband will love me.'"
33 Concebeu de novo e deu à luz outro filho. "O Senhor, disse ela, vendo que era desdenhada, deu-me ainda este." E pôs-lhe o nome de Simeão.33 She conceived again and bore a son, and said, "It means, 'The LORD heard that I was unloved,' and therefore he has given me this one also"; so she named him Simeon.
34 Concebeu ainda e deu à luz mais um filho. "Desta vez, disse ela, meu marido se apegará a mim, porque já lhe dei à luz três filhos." Por isso deu-lhe o nome de Levi.34 Again she conceived and bore a son, and she said, "Now at last my husband will become attached to me, since I have now borne him three sons"; that is why she named him Levi.
35 Concebeu ainda e deu à luz um filho. E disse: "Desta vez, louvarei ao Senhor." E chamou-o Judá. Depois cessou de ter filhos.35 Once more she conceived and bore a son, and she said, "This time I will give grateful praise to the LORD"; therefore she named him Judah. Then she stopped bearing children.
